On This Day: March 19 1983 First Lady Nancy Reagan Appeared on Diff’rent Strokes to Promote the Just Say No Campaign
On this day March 19 1983 First Lady Nancy Reagan made a special guest appearance on an episode of Diff’rent Strokes as part of her nationwide Just Say No campaign against drug use.

The episode titled The Reporter was the 22nd episode of season five and featured Mrs Reagan visiting Arnold’s school to speak about the dangers of drugs. Her appearance was part of a broader effort to raise awareness about drug prevention through pop culture and television.

Fun fact: Nancy Reagan’s appearance on Diff’rent Strokes was one of the first times a sitting First Lady guest-starred on a sitcom making it a historic television moment.
